The global landscape of aging and exercise research (1922-2024): A multi-dataset bibliometric mapping and thematic evolution analysis.

PURPOSE Exercise and physical activity are essential for promoting healthy aging by improving physical function, preventing cognitive decline, and reducing chronic disease risk. Despite increasing research output, a comprehensive bibliometric synthesis of aging and exercise research (AER), particularly its intellectual structure and emerging trends, remains limited. This study aimed to map the evolution and thematic structure of AER. METHODS Bibliographic data were retrieved from the Scopus database (as of 13 December 2024). Three datasets (N1 = 11,751; N2 = 4722; N3 = 3880) covering different periods and core sources were analyzed. Bibliometrix, VOSviewer, and CiteSpace were used to assess publication trends, author productivity, collaboration networks, thematic evolution, keyword co-occurrence, and co-citation patterns. RESULTS AER publications increased substantially after 1980, with peak citation impact in 1991 (412.67 citations/article). Publication output reached 1086 articles in 2024, while recent citation averages declined due to recency effects. The Journal of Aging and Physical Activity and Journals of Gerontology were identified as core sources. The United States led in productivity and collaboration, and McAuley E. was the most prolific author. Author productivity followed Lotka's law, with 71.9% of authors contributing a single article. Key themes included physical activity, aging, and exercise, with emerging topics such as sarcopenia, telerehabilitation, and multicomponent exercise. CONCLUSION This bibliometric analysis provides a comprehensive overview of AER, identifying key contributors, core sources, and emerging trends, and offers insights to guide future interdisciplinary research and promote healthy aging.
